Disability shower installation services focus on creating accessible bathing spaces that accommodate individuals with mobility challenges or other physical limitations. These services typically involve replacing standard shower setups with customized solutions such as walk-in showers, low-threshold entries, and safety features like grab bars, non-slip flooring, and seating options. The goal is to enhance safety and independence within the bathroom, making daily routines easier and reducing the risk of slips and falls. Local service providers can assist in designing and installing showers that meet specific accessibility needs, ensuring compliance with safety considerations and personal preferences.

This service addresses common problems faced by individuals with limited mobility, such as difficulty stepping over high tub walls or maneuvering in tight spaces. Traditional showers and tubs can pose hazards or become impractical for those with balance issues, arthritis, or other health concerns. Installing an accessible shower can help mitigate these issues by providing a safer, more user-friendly environment. Professional installers work to optimize the layout and features of the shower area, ensuring that it not only meets accessibility standards but also integrates seamlessly with the existing bathroom design.

The overview below groups typical Disability Shower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Chesterfield, MO.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Installation Costs - The typical cost for installing a disability shower ranges from $1,500 to $4,000, depending on the complexity of the setup and materials used. Basic models may be closer to the lower end, while custom features increase the price.

Material Expenses - The price of materials for disability showers can vary from $500 to $2,500. Options like waterproof tiles, grab bars, and accessible doors influence the overall material costs.

Labor Fees - Labor charges for installing a disability shower usually fall between $800 and $2,500. The total depends on the existing plumbing and structural modifications needed.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as permits, custom modifications, or upgrading plumbing can add $200 to $1,000 to the project. Costs vary based on the specific requirements of each installation in Chesterfield and nearby areas.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
